Technology/STEM Teacher Grades PreK-12+ within the READS Academy Program
$60,147–$100,721 year
On-site · West Bridgewater, Massachusetts, United States
Job Summary
Direct instruction of Technology/STEM to PreK-12 students within the READS Academy Program, including teaching the Work Based Learning Technology Employability Skills track for grades 9-12 (two blocks daily) with internal internship positions and monthly in-person consultation at West Bridgewater High School. Requires strong organizational and classroom-management skills, effective communication, and the ability to supervise support personnel. Preferred experience with classroom technology integration, zSpace, 3-D printing, programming and robotics, and experience supporting students with social/emotional and behavioral challenges. Willingness to attend Crisis Prevention Institute Nonviolent Crisis Intervention training. Position is in-person and available immediately; pay range $60,147 to $100,721 per year. Benefits include dental, health, retirement, professional development, and tuition reimbursement.
Required Qualifications
- Licensed Technology Teacher or Special Education Teacher with background in technology or vocational teacher with technology focus
- DESE Licensure in related field or eligible for waiver
- Crisis Prevention Institute: Nonviolent Crisis Intervention certification required
- Experience with integrating technology in classroom instruction; willingness to be trained on zSpace; knowledge of 3-D printing; experience with programming/robotics preferred
- experience working with students with disabilities including social, emotional, learning, behavioral challenges preferred
